Irene and I returned Saturday from a cruise to Desolation Sound and back from Anacortes. We were warm and dry with our Wallas, plus an electric heater at the marinas. We stayed at Poets' Cove, Pender Harbor, Laura Cove [anchored], French Creek, Nanaimo, and Victoria.

The winds were mostly light and the intermittent, expected rain was not a problem.

The only negative was sleeping-berth moisture, about which we've reviewed prior posts and intend to take some sort of action.

We had a great time. This was by far our longest cruise, and we're encouraged now to take more off-season trips.
